Transaction

24f06e240fb6f0ccfc7488f0bca26cebc5ed75b8e4333c1596de2d7b6b069e9f
667,802 confirmations
Timestamp
1386290707
Block273,276
Fee10,000 sats
Fee rate44.6 sats/vB
view on mempool.space

Inputs & Outputs